Director Duval O'Neill leads the Christchurch studio alongside HMOA Associate Nic Sewell. Duval, Nic and the rest of the Christchurch studio work on both commercial and residential projects, with particular expertise in large multi-unit developments. The team works across the South Island including on projects in Central Otago, like the award-winning Wanaka House.

Born and bred in Southland, Duval was lead architect on the Clifton Hill House, a finalist in the 2013 Home of the Year, and is known for his remarkable work on other Christchurch modernist homes. There's a great story behind the design of Duval's own home in Mt Pleasant, which replaced a Don Cowey-designed 1950s home destroyed by the Christchurch earthquakes.

The Christchurch studio is at 65 Cambridge Tce, Sir Miles Warren's original office and apartment – and an inspiring place to go to work each day.
